Commissioner Webb outlines RTC plan to repurpose roughly $105 million in transit funds for DART-area connections

Collin County Commissioners Court · February 16, 2026

Commissioner Webb reported that the Regional Transportation Council advanced a plan to reprioritize about $105 million in future transit receipts—over an open-ended timeline—to support two major projects linking the A-train to the Silver Line and Trinity Metro to DFW Airport; the update also covered a separate $75 million package for DART.

Commissioner Webb told the Collin County Commissioners Court that the Regional Transportation Council meeting last week focused on DART and on a concept to redirect roughly $105 million of future transit funds to two regional rail connection projects.

Webb said the RTC discussed redesignating funds that normally flow into the region’s general transit allocations so they specifically support connecting the A-train to the Silver Line and linking Trinity Metro to Dallas/Fort Worth International Airport. ‘‘These two projects are huge projects, are very well supported by the region,’’ Webb said.
